-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
单元9 扩展模块 回顾 1,数据通信有哪些方式? 2,8051单片机串行通信通过哪些管脚完成? 3,8051单片机串行通信有几种工作方式? 4,波特率的定义是什么?8051单片机设置波特率的步骤? 5,Max232芯片作用是什么? 本单元任务 任务1 扩展程序存储器 任务2 扩展数据存储器 任务3 扩展I/O 任务1 扩展程序存储器 1.半导体存储器基本知识 只读存储器ROM :ROM(Read Only Memory)是只读存储器。ROM中所存储的信息是固定的、非易失性的,不会因为停电而消失。在正常工作状态下,ROM中的信息只能读不能写,即不能修改ROM的内容,数据读出后原数据不变。ROM通常用来存储控制程序和控制常量 掩模ROM PROM EPROM (EEPROM ) Flash Memory 随机存取存储器RAM RAM(Random Access Memory)是随机存取存储器。正常工作时信息既可读出又可写入。数据读出后原数据不变,新数据写入后,原数据自然消失,并被新数据代替。因此,RAM存储器可以用来存储实时数据、中间数据、最终结果或作为程序的堆栈区使用。但是,RAM是易失性存储器,掉电后其数据随即消失。 RAM通常可分为静态RAM和动态RAM两大类,其差别主要在于基本存储电路存储信息的方式不同。静态RAM依靠触发器来存储二进制信息,存储容量较小。动态RAM依靠存储电容来存储二进制信息,存储容量大 2.单片机存储器扩展的实现 P0口线用作数据线/低8位地址线 P0口线具有地址线/数据线双重复用功能,以ALE为锁存控制信号,选择高电平或下降沿选通的锁存器作为地址锁存器(通常使用的锁存器是74LS373或74LS273),确保低8位地址信息在消失前被送入锁存器暂存起来,从而实现了对地址和数据的分离 P2口线用作高8位地址线 P2口线用于进行高8位地址线的扩展。由于只具有地址线扩展的功能,P2口线可直接与存储器芯片的地址线相连,无需锁存。P2与P0提供的16根地址线实现了51单片机系统64KB的寻址范围 控制信号 (1)ALE是锁存信号,用于进行P0口地址线和数据线的隔离。 (2) 是程序存储器读选通控制信号。 (3) 是程序存储器访问控制信号。当它为低电平时,对程序存储器的访问仅限于外部存储器;为高电平时,对程序存储器的访问从单片机的内部存储器开始延至外部存储器。 (4) 、 是外部数据存储器的读/写选通控制信号 3.片选方式及地址映像 片选方式研究多个芯片扩展时的连线,从而保证对存储芯片访问的惟一性。地址映像则研究各存储器芯片在整个存储空间中所占据的地址范围,从而为存储器的使用提供依据 片选方式 存储器编址是扩展存储器的重点。所谓存储器编址,就是使用系统提供的地址线,通过适当的连接,最终达到一个编址唯一地对应存储器中一个存储单元的目的。通常的单片机系统都会扩展多片存储器芯片,因此存储器编址应从两个方面进行考虑: (1)存储芯片的选择,即片选。用来解决与芯片的片选端连接问题; (2)芯片内部存储单元的选择,用来解决与芯片的地址线连接问题。 芯片的选择有两种方式:线选和译码 (1)线选方式 :直接以系统的高地址作为存储芯片的片选信号,为此只需把用到的地址线与存储器的片选端直接连接即可。同时最多只能有一个存储器芯片被选中,此时,与被选中芯片相连的地址线有效,其他用于线选的地址线均无效 (2)译码方式 :使用译码器对系统的高位地址进行译码,以译码输出作为存储芯片的片选信号。这是一种最常用的片选方式,能有效利用存储空间,适用于大容量多芯片存储器的扩展 当扩展的同类存储器芯片的存储容量相同时,译码方式可产生连续的地址映像,充分利用存储空间。具体做法是: (1)若用于地址线扩展的P2口线是~,则从起与译码器输入选择端依照高低次序进行连接。 (2)多个芯片的片选端依次与相邻的译码输出端相连。 下面以扩展多片存储容量为2KB的存储器芯片为例进行说明。则每片存储器的地址线数量为11条(A10~A0),即P0经锁存器后为地址低8位(A7~A0),P2口的~用于地址扩展(A10~A8),译码电路则从P2.3起始,若采用74LS138作为译码器,电路如下 地址映像 对存储器芯片进行地址映像,是对存储器进行访问的前提。现在以扩展2KB存储容量的芯片进行说明。如图9-3所示,设4片存储芯片的片选端分别与Y0、Y1、Y2、Y3相连,则扩展4片存储器芯片时,P2、P0口各引脚连线对应关系如下 其中 ~ 、 ~ 用于片内地址的选择,范围从000 0000 0000B到111 1111 1111B。
您可能关注的文档
最近下载
- 公路水运工程试验检测考试(桥梁隧道)习题库(第4部分).pdf VIP
- 济南城市轨道交通4号线一期工程环境影响报告书(受理公示).pdf VIP
- 公路水运工程试验检测考试(桥梁隧道)习题库(第3部分).pdf VIP
- 公路水运工程试验检测考试(桥梁隧道)习题库(第2部分).pdf VIP
- 一种氟硅酸制备氢氟酸联产白炭黑的方法.pdf VIP
- 物质的量(一)孙红保1案例.ppt
- 云南省红河哈尼族彝族自治州蒙自市2024部编版小升初语文全真模拟测试卷.pdf VIP
- 控轧控冷-.ppt VIP
- 成都七中科学城2025小升初入学分班考试语文考试试题及答案.docx VIP
- 燃煤电厂锅炉烟气袋式除尘工程技术规范 DLT 1121-2020.docx VIP
文档评论(0)